What This Data Tells You About Earlsboro Volunteer Fire Department

Earlsboro Volunteer Fire Department operates as a Volunteer department in Earlsboro, within Pottawatomie County, and the HIFLD and USFA records give a precise structural picture of its response capacity. The department reports 14 total personnel, 2 stations, no truck inventory reported. EMS capability is listed as not provided.

Benchmarking against the state gives this profile context. Oklahoma has 1,049 registered fire departments and 12,710 total personnel, averaging roughly 12 staff per department. Earlsboro Volunteer Fire Department runs 17% above that state average, signalling a larger-than-typical crew likely tied to denser population or higher call volume. The state records about 29,600 fires, 68 fire deaths, and 44% volunteer coverage each year, which shapes training, funding priorities, and mutual-aid patterns felt at every department in the state.

No FEMA AFG or SAFER grant awards are recorded against this department's FDID in USAspending data, which is common for smaller or volunteer-heavy organizations that lean on state and local funding instead.
